像学母语一样
Learn Chinese the way you learned your first language
You didn’t study your first language. You understood it until it stuck. Chinese is no different.
Step 1
Listen to Chinese you can follow
Every episode is pitched just above where you are, so you catch the gist and soak up the rest from context. Understandable input is the one thing every fluent speaker got, and the one thing drills can’t fake.

Step 2
Let the meaning sink in on its own
No memorizing, no grammar tables. Hear a word in enough real moments and it starts to mean something on its own, the way Nihao never needed a translation. You acquire Chinese instead of studying it.

Step 3
Rack up the hours, level by level
Start with slow, simple stories and step up only when it feels easy, from HSK 1 all the way to native-speed news. Put in the hours and one day you catch yourself just understanding.
